Halo 3 Trailer

The Halo 3 Trailer is out, and, aside from being stunningly gorgeous, it drops a nice reference to those of us who have been awaiting the game since before it even existed, since February 16th, 1999 when Hamish Sinclair got an email that read:

I have walked the edge of the Abyss.
I have governed the unwilling.
I have witnessed countless empires break before me.
I have seen the most courageous soldiers fall away in fear.
[I was there with the Angel at the tomb]
I have seen your future.
And I have learned.

There will be no more Sadness. No more Anger. No more Envy.

I HAVE WON.

Oh, and your poet Eliot had it all wrong:
THIS is the way the world ends.

Well done, Bungie. You might just have gotten me to buy an Xbox 360.
